Overview
- Federal inmate records now list Sean “Diddy” Combs’ projected release as June 4, 2028, a shift from May 8 previously shown on the Bureau of Prisons website.
- No reason for the change has been provided by the Bureau of Prisons, and outlets noted the agency was not available for comment during a lapse in appropriations.
- Recent coverage cited allegations that Combs consumed homemade alcohol and took part in a prohibited three-way call; his representatives called the accounts false and said the call was attorney‑client communication.
- Combs is serving a 50‑month sentence after July convictions on two Mann Act counts and an October sentencing; he was transferred to low‑security FCI Fort Dix on October 30.
- His spokesperson says he is enrolled in the Residential Drug Abuse Program and working in the chapel library, and his legal team has filed an appeal.
